Linux守护进程编写指南守护进程(Daemon)是运行在后台的一种特殊进程。它独立于控制终端并且周期性地执行某种任务或等待处理某些发生的事件。 守护进程是一种很有用的进 程。Linux的大多数服务器就是用守护进程实现的。比如,Internet服务器inetd,Web服务器 httpd等。同时,守护...
分类:
系统相关 时间:
2015-04-08 12:36:43
阅读次数:
193
在说nginx前,先来看看什么是“惊群”?简单说来,多线程/多进程(linux下线程进程也没多大区别)等待同一个socket事件,当这个事件发生时,这些线程/进程被同时唤醒,就是惊群。可以想见,效率很低下,许多进程被内核重新调度唤醒,同时去响应这一个事件,当然只有一个进程能处理事件成功,其他的进程在...
分类:
其他好文 时间:
2015-03-30 12:50:42
阅读次数:
152
之前只是了解到linux中的fork函数是用来创建进程,并没有太多的去学习,这里学习记录如下。
撰写不易,转载需注明出处:http://blog.csdn.net/jscese/article/details/44401389 本文来自 【jscese】的博客!定义:来自百科的解释:fork函数将运行着的程序分成2个(几乎)完全一样的进程,每个进程都启动一个从代码的同一位置开始执行的线程。这两个进程...
分类:
系统相关 时间:
2015-03-18 12:25:04
阅读次数:
168
Linux查看非root运行的进程
youhaidong@youhaidong-ThinkPad-Edge-E545:~$ ps -U root -u root -N
PID TTY TIME CMD
663 ? 00:00:00 dbus-daemon
713 ? 00:00:00 rsyslogd
730 ? ...
分类:
系统相关 时间:
2015-03-13 23:49:27
阅读次数:
450
Linux显示所有运行中的进程
youhaidong@youhaidong-ThinkPad-Edge-E545:~$ ps aux | less
USER PID %CPU %MEM VSZ RSS TTY STAT START TIME COMMAND
root 1 0.0 0.1 33788 3172 ? Ss ...
分类:
系统相关 时间:
2015-03-13 23:48:59
阅读次数:
1104
Linux查看当前正在运行的进程
youhaidong@youhaidong-ThinkPad-Edge-E545:~$ ps
PID TTY TIME CMD
2576 pts/0 00:00:00 bash
2695 pts/0 00:00:00 ps...
分类:
系统相关 时间:
2015-03-13 23:48:52
阅读次数:
804
Linux查看系统中的每个进程
youhaidong@youhaidong-ThinkPad-Edge-E545:~$ ps -A
PID TTY TIME CMD
1 ? 00:00:01 init
2 ? 00:00:00 kthreadd
3 ? 00:00:00 ksoftirqd/0
...
分类:
系统相关 时间:
2015-03-13 23:47:02
阅读次数:
3403
守护进程(Daemon)的定义:在Linux或UNIX操作系统中,在系统引导的时候会开启很多服务,这些服务就叫做守护进程。守 护进程(Daemon)是运行在后台的一种特殊进程。它独立于控制终端并且周期性地执行某种任务或等待处理某些发生的事件。守护进程是一种很有用的进程。 Linux的大多数服务器就是...
分类:
系统相关 时间:
2015-03-11 21:18:24
阅读次数:
198
守护进程(Daemon)是运行在后台的一种特殊进程。它独立于控制终端并且周期性地执行某种任务或等待处理某些发生的事件。守护进程是一种很有用的进程。Linux的大多数服务器就是用守护进程实现的。
分类:
系统相关 时间:
2015-03-10 18:58:12
阅读次数:
195
守护进程(Daemon)是运行在后台的一种特殊进程。它独立于控制终端并且周期性地执行某种任务或等待处理某些发生的事件。守护进程是一种很有用的进程。 Linux的大多数服务器就是用守护进程实现的。比如,Internet服务...
分类:
系统相关 时间:
2015-03-04 17:10:57
阅读次数:
159